Beyond the Crown Jewels – discover what most visitors miss.

The Tower of London is one of the most iconic sites in the world — a fortress, a palace, a prison, and a symbol of British power. But just beyond its moat lies a quieter London, rich in secrets and surprise. Here are five spots worth exploring next time you visit:

1. St Dunstan in the East

Just a 5-minute walk from the Tower, this bombed-out church has been transformed into a peaceful garden of stone and ivy. It’s one of London’s most photogenic ruins — quiet, contemplative, and entirely free to enter.

2. All Hallows by the Tower

Older than the Tower itself, this often-overlooked church dates back to AD 675. Beneath the nave is a small but fascinating crypt museum — including a Roman floor and an altar that survived the Great Fire of 1666.

3. Postman’s Park

Tucked behind the Museum of London, this green space holds a unique memorial: a wall of hand-painted tiles commemorating ordinary Londoners who died saving others. Quiet, powerful, and very human.

4. The London Roman Wall

A surviving section of the 2,000-year-old Roman city wall lies just behind Tower Hill Station. Most people pass it without noticing, but it’s a direct link to the city’s earliest history — and it’s hiding in plain sight.

5. Wilton’s Music Hall

A little further east lies the world’s oldest surviving grand music hall — still in operation. With original gas lamps, peeling wallpaper, and a packed calendar of performances, Wilton’s is pure Victorian atmosphere.
